    The Emily in Paris Season 5 Trailer Will Make You Feel Fireworks

    A whole new spin around the City of Love — and Rome — is on the way.

    Dec. 3, 2025

Grab the champagne — Emily in Paris Season 5 is on the way. Or should we say, pop the prosecco? As the just-released trailer confirms, the fizzy heroine Emily Cooper (Lily Collins) is taking a detour from her beloved French city in favor of fair Rome, Italy. 

Last season, Emily’s boss, Sylvie (Philippine Leroy-Beaulieu), asked her to open up a new Agence Grateau office in the Eternal City. The clip, seen above, reveals that the rom-com’s leading lady will mean business when Emily in Paris returns on Dec. 18. Emily’s got a new man (Eugenio Franceschini as cashmere mogul Marcello Muratori), new obstacles, and a dolce new outlook.  

“She’s bolder, braver, stronger, and more adventurous,” Collins says. “She’s in a new city and a new country, figuring out her life, love, and work.”

While Emily applies her usual can-do attitude to her latest chapter, the trailer hints at some growing pains ahead. Marcello may be so enamored with Emily that he’s flirting in meetings, but his mother Antonia (Anna Galiena), is less than impressed by the American marketing exec’s ideas. At least Emily has a sleek new look that combines her Italian escapades and French savoir faire — and keeps her walking tall in her stilettos

“The new look feels like her way of saying, ‘I’ve matured, I’m taking myself more seriously — so please take me seriously, too’ — while also embracing the idea of taking life itself a little less seriously,” Collins says. “There’s a sense of her letting go — literally and figuratively — of some of the weight she’s carried. She’s living life a bit more freely and carelessly, even if she still has her stressful moments.”

All of this growth has Emily in Paris creator and executive producer Darren Star calling the adventure ahead “one of [his] favorite seasons” of the series. “The story feels very fresh to me,” he says. “The relationships feel more mature this season, and I think there’s a lot for the entire ensemble to do.”

In the trailer, we get a peek at what “bigger and richer and deeper” stories Star has cooked up for Emily in Paris’s sprawling cast. Mindy (Ashley Park) and Alfie (Lucien Laviscount) share loaded glances back in Paris. Sylvie shows her soft side. And, Gabriel (Lucas Bravo) looks toward “the future.” 

So what does destiny have in store for Emily in Paris? Find out when Season 5 premieres on Dec. 18 on Netflix
